titleOfInvention Negative electrode active material for nonaqueous electrolyte battery, nonaqueous electrolyte battery, battery pack, and vehicle
abstract A negative electrode active material contains a metal-displaced lithium-titanium oxide of a ramsdellite structure expressed by the formula Li (16/7)-x Ti (24/7)-y M y O 8 (where M is at least one metal element selected from the group consisting of Nb, Ta, Mo, and W, and x and y are respectively numbers in the range of 0<x<16/7 and 0<y<24/7).
